**Ticket: Config drift on tile cache nodes**

The Maplet tile-rendering cache layer has drifted across the three render nodes — eviction settings no longer match what's in the repo. New folks: never hand-edit node configs; changes go through the deploy pipeline or they get clobbered and cause drift like this. Reconcile all nodes to the canonical values listed below.

config for tagep-yajef:
ulawyn:
  log_level: error
  metrics_host: metrics.ulawyn.lumiclabs.internal
  pin: 0564
  pool_size: 32

Confirm that every service in the Lanternview stack propagates the trace header on both inbound and outbound calls, including async handoffs through the Quillbus queue. Spot-check three request paths per service and verify spans appear end-to-end in the trace viewer with no orphaned segments. Services failing propagation must be flagged in the sync notes with a remediation ticket opened before Friday. Any exceptions require written rationale. Questions about this item should be directed to the owner listed below.

account owner for bawip-tahag: Raleth Quenok

**14:22** — Okay, this is where it got weird. The Feedwren validator started accepting podcast feeds with malformed enclosure tags, which it definitely shouldn't. Priya traced it to a parser regression shipped that morning. For the security review, the offending build is identified by the token below.

trace token, fafog-kageg: htk4_98e6

**Onboarding: ProctorQueue review notes**

ProctorQueue schedules live exam-proctoring sessions for Veritall Assessments. Reviewers: reject any change that touches session ordering without an updated fairness test, and require idempotency on all queue mutations — duplicate enqueues have caused double-billing before. Migrations must be backward compatible for one release. Architecture doc and invariants list live in the repo root. Questions on invariants or review standards go to the queue maintainers at the address below.

escalation mailbox, yajeg-bageg: quenax.olidor@lumiccorp.internal